Rap star Cardi B finds public feuds 'exhausting'
Published in Entertainment News
Cardi B feels "tired" of her public feuds.
The 33-year-old rap star has become embroiled in several spats and controversies during her time in the spotlight, and Cardi admits that the "drama" can be exhausting.
The rapper - whose new album is called Am I the Drama? - told PAPER Magazine: "I be every kind of tired and it exhausts me.
"There's drama that I expected to come. Because if I'm throwing shots at b******, I expect the drama to come from them. I'm not gonna act like, 'Oh, it wasn't gonna come when I'm directly talking to you'. I can't be surprised that a b**** is trying me, because I pull their cards.
"However, when people just be trying you, and you're not even paying attention to them, you're not even talking to them about them, it's like, 'This is why I say that I am the drama'.
"I even bother b****** when I don't even give them attention. It's still an issue. So that just means that is that. I am the drama. No matter how much I avoid it is gonna come to me."
